We have introduced our children to a range of club activities and hobbies which would provide them with diverse learning opportunities. These clubs will help them to identify their skills and develop interests which would enable them to organize their spare time constructively. Clubs and Hobbies are during school hours at no extra cost with partime specialists where needed. Hobbies are twice a week. Some of the clubs are
